Yedidyah Bar David has uploaded a new change for review. Change subject: packaging: setup: use engine package env for versionlock ......................................................................
packaging: setup: use engine package env for versionlock Compliment Ibad05b1e0283b0b27fb278a0ba15b3f7e95d747c Related-To: https://bugzilla.redhat.com/1076046 Change-Id: I5bcd649ee872269b9e687e0517a5b6de6f81284d Signed-off-by: Yedidyah Bar David <d...@redhat.com> --- M packaging/setup/ovirt_engine_setup/constants.py M packaging/setup/plugins/ovirt-engine-setup/ovirt-engine/distro-rpm/packages.py 2 files changed, 26 insertions(+), 16 deletions(-) git pull ssh://gerrit.ovirt.org:29418/ovirt-engine refs/changes/00/26100/1 diff --git a/packaging/setup/ovirt_engine_setup/constants.py b/packaging/setup/ovirt_engine_setup/constants.py index 69e4914..9a844ab 100644 --- a/packaging/setup/ovirt_engine_setup/constants.py +++ b/packaging/setup/ovirt_engine_setup/constants.py @@ -601,20 +601,16 @@ UPGRADE_YUM_GROUP_NAME = 'ovirt-engine-3.4' @classproperty - def RPM_LOCK_LIST(self): - return tuple([ - '{name}%s'.format( - name=self.ENGINE_PACKAGE_NAME, - ) % package for package in ( - '', - '-backend', - '-dbscripts', - '-restapi', - '-tools', - '-userportal', - '-webadmin-portal', - ) - ]) + def RPM_LOCK_LIST_SUFFIXES(self): + return ( + '', + '-backend', + '-dbscripts', + '-restapi', + '-tools', + '-userportal', + '-webadmin-portal', + ) FILE_GROUP_SECTION_PREFIX = 'file_group_' diff --git a/packaging/setup/plugins/ovirt-engine-setup/ovirt-engine/distro-rpm/packages.py b/packaging/setup/plugins/ovirt-engine-setup/ovirt-engine/distro-rpm/packages.py index 1ffa976..db4993d 100644 --- a/packaging/setup/plugins/ovirt-engine-setup/ovirt-engine/distro-rpm/packages.py +++ b/packaging/setup/plugins/ovirt-engine-setup/ovirt-engine/distro-rpm/packages.py @@ -58,10 +58,24 @@ self.environment[ osetupcons.RPMDistroEnv.VERSION_LOCK_FILTER - ].append(osetupcons.Const.ENGINE_PACKAGE_NAME) + ].extend( + tolist( + self.environment[osetupcons.RPMDistroEnv.ENGINE_PACKAGES] + ) + ) self.environment[ osetupcons.RPMDistroEnv.VERSION_LOCK_APPLY - ].extend(osetupcons.Const.RPM_LOCK_LIST) + ].extend( + [ + "%s%s" % (prefix, suffix) + for prefix in tolist( + self.environment[ + osetupcons.RPMDistroEnv.ENGINE_PACKAGES + ] + ) + for suffix in osetupcons.Const.RPM_LOCK_LIST_SUFFIXES + ] + ) self.environment[ osetupcons.RPMDistroEnv.PACKAGES_UPGRADE_LIST ].append( -- To view, visit http://gerrit.ovirt.org/26100 To unsubscribe, visit http://gerrit.ovirt.org/settings Gerrit-MessageType: newchange Gerrit-Change-Id: I5bcd649ee872269b9e687e0517a5b6de6f81284d Gerrit-PatchSet: 1 Gerrit-Project: ovirt-engine Gerrit-Branch: master Gerrit-Owner: Yedidyah Bar David <d...@redhat.com> _______________________________________________ Engine-patches mailing list Engine-patches@ovirt.org http://lists.ovirt.org/mailman/listinfo/engine-patches